In cell biology, the nucleus (pl. nuclei; from Latin nucleus or nuculeus, “little nut” or kernel) is a membrane-enclosed organelle found in most eukaryotic cells. It contains most of the cell's genetic material, organized as multiple long linear DNA molecules in complex with a large variety of proteins, such as histones [w], to form chromosomes. - wikipedia
